Annual export data Bahrain · UN Comtrade
| Year | Export value (US$) | Volume | Avg price/kg |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$2.9K | 1.1 t | $2.71 |
| 2023 | $264 | 0.2 t | $1.1 |
| 2022 | $8.6K | 1.5 t | $5.65 |
| 2021 | $15.4K | 1.3 t | $11.96 |
| 2020 | $18 | 0 t | $1.1 |
HS Code
kale is traded under Harmonized System code 0704.90. Trade figures above are compiled for this HS heading.
